XLE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2017 in Review

716 of the 4,011 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in State Street Energy Select Sector SPDR ETF (XLE) for Q2 2017, worth a combined $9.46B — down 9.3% from $10.4B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 88 funds closed out of XLE and 67 opened new positions — a net loss of 21 holders — while 283 trimmed existing stakes and 267 added.

The largest buyer was Charles Schwab Investment Advisory, opening a new position worth an estimated $141M. The largest seller was Bank of America, cutting an estimated $280M.
